Citizens National Bank is a historic bank building located at Springville, Erie County, New York. It was built in 1939, and is a two-story, five bay, square brick building with Moderne style design elements. The interior features a mural titled "Credit Man's Confidence in Man" and painted by noted artist Louis Grell. The building housed a bank until 1968, when it was sold to the Village of Springville.

The building was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1996.

There is also a fallout shelter inside with five inch concrete walls and capabilities to hold up to 400 people for 6 months
